Transaction 6140ce693d58b6bb18cb83f956b521c71f06ee208933cebc5c81ab5af12b0bb9

2 Input
1 Outputs
  • 6140ce693d58b6bb18cb83f956b521c71f06ee208933cebc5c81ab5af12b0bb9:0
  • value  503515
    address  3AWQHh7mgTm54R1hksBY4tZNNKe18KRbUA